Welcome to Be Well Counseling Services! I’m Megan Kuder, an Atlanta based Licensed Professional Counselor specializing in helping individuals navigate through issues related to anxiety, depression, trauma, and life transitions so that they can attain a sense of freedom, hope, and courage to more boldly step forward into their life. I also specialize in seeing dating, pre-marital, and married couples. I work with dating/premarital couples to help them discern their next steps in relationship while I work with married couples who are in need of help navigating the complexities of relationship through building healthy communication & conflict resolution skills in a warm yet direct environment that promotes empathy and understanding.
The name of my counseling practice, “Be Well” is purposeful in that I believe true wellness comes from a holistic understanding of mental, physical and spiritual health. I work from a perspective of seeing the whole person, mind-body-spirit, and will co-create treatment goals with each client individually, recognizing that each person is created uniquely and perfectly for a purpose. I work from a Christian understanding of spiritual formation, and will gladly incorporate this into sessions should a client desire this type of work in their therapy. However, I do not require clients to have the same belief system as myself in order to work with me in therapy as I consider myself respectful and sensitive to other’s beliefs and values, thus this is something that I will discuss with each client in our initial intake session so we can best work together. Clients often initially enter into therapy in a state of distress and apprehension, and after building a safe space together and working through the therapeutic process, they leave therapy feeling encouraged, equipped and empowered to move forward into their lives more confidently and with more energy and excitement towards the future.
BACKGROUND
I’ve been working as a counselor in the the Atlanta area for more than six years, and throughout this time I have been fortunate enough to work in a variety of clinical settings including: in-home residential recovery programs, private practice, a psychiatric hospital setting, and a church-based counseling center that I personally helped bring to the state of Georgia in 2013-2014 and that I have recently left to begin my own counseling business. I’ve most recently opened up my own private practice in East Atlanta in hopes of providing even better services to fewer clients who truly want to see change in their life and who are willing to work with me to attain their treatment goals.
MY EDUCATION & QUALIFICATIONS INCLUDE :
• Licensed Professional Counselor (LPC009070)
• Master’s degree in Professional Counseling, Richmont Graduate University
• Bachelor’s degree of Arts in Political Science, the University of Florida
• Gottman Method Couples Therapy, Level One
• Prepare/Enrich Certified Facilitator
• EMDR (Eye Movement Desensitization and Reprocessing, a trauma-informed therapy modality) Level 1 & 2 Certified
I am also a member of the American Counseling Association and receive monthly training through their online continuing education.

COST
$125 per 50 minute session
Accepted forms of payment include: cash, check, card, HSA/FSA. I do not accept insurance as an in-network provider, however, I will gladly give you a superbill that you can submit to your insurance company. I do not guarantee reimbursement as every insurance company is different and I cannot be held responsible for an insurance company’s decision. Also, I understand that things come up, so you can cancel or reschedule your appointment with at least 24 business hours notice. If it’s less than 24 business hours notice, you will be charged for the full appointment.
